Zion National Park
Zion National Park is about 45 minutes from St George and is open year round. The best time to visit and play in Zion is late Fall when the temperatures have cooled, the tourists are gone and the leaves are changing to brilliant red, orange and yellow. The sights and the smells are incredible! | |

Grand Canyon
Taken from Tuweap, which is about 90 miles from St George on a dirt road. This is an area of the Grand Canyon seldom seen by visitors. | |

Coyote Buttes
This is called "The Wave" and it is in the Paria Canyon area which is about halfway between St George and Lake Powell. | |
Gooseberry Mesa
Gooseberry Mesa is one of the most famous Mountain Biking areas in the Country and is located just outside of Hurricane, UT. The scenery all along the bike trails is spectacular | |
